Internal Collector Fouling
Visible algae or dirt buildup inside clear Fafco panel tubes, reducing performance.

Possible Causes
Poor pool water chemistry, Long periods of stagnation in panels, No periodic high-flow flushing, Organic debris entering solar loop
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ety: Handle pool chemicals carefully and follow all safety instructions.
- Balance water: Test and correct pool chemistry, especially sanitizer and pH, to prevent algae growth.
- Flush panels: Periodically run the Fafco system at full flow to help scour internal surfaces.
- Install strainer: Ensure a fine strainer or filter is present before the solar feed to prevent debris entry.
- Severe fouling: If performance remains poor, panels may need professional cleaning or replacement.
